While Legislative Hurdles Remain, We Take a Look at North Carolina’s Medical Marijuana Bill

Cannabis Law Report

SB 711 recognizes that “modern medical research has found that cannabis and cannabinoid compounds are effective at alleviating pain, nausea, and other symptoms associated with several debilitating medical conditions.”. SB 711 would make medical marijuana available to “qualified patients” with a physician’s written certification.

The Baltic Times: Cannabis policy reform in Lithuania: history, current status, and future challenges

Cannabis Law Report

If passed by the Parliament, the legislation will remove the need for criminal investigations when someone is caught with a personal amount of the substance. The law also allows the sale of products made from hemp but only if they contain zero THC.
